Transaction 3ae2bf7124cabce20522897f5fa9101660bb0c1b029b5d83541ebbff5d3365e3

1 Input
1 Outputs
  • 3ae2bf7124cabce20522897f5fa9101660bb0c1b029b5d83541ebbff5d3365e3:0
  • value  5547990
    address  3CMmXt1UaEbbHzZrEdadzrFsQ81oUiwJNK